Luang Prabang 03 Nights / 04 Days
Itinerary :
Day 1 :
Luang Prabang : Arrival in Luang Prabang. Transfer to Hotel. Visit the oldest living temple in Luang Prabang, Wat Visoun dates back to 1513 and contains a collection of antique wooden Buddhas. Visit the nearby Wat Aham before continuing to Wat Xieng Thong, the crowning jewel of all the monasteries and temples in the city. Time permitting, stop at some of the many temples that line its sides, including Wat Sibounheuang, Wat Si Moungkhoun, Wat Sop and Wat Sene. Overnight in Luang Prabang.
Day 2 :
Luang Prabang (B) : Excursion to Pak Ou Caves by vehicle. They are full of Buddha images of varying styles, ages and sizes. Visit to Ban Xang Hai located near the Pak Ou Caves, this village was once a 'Jar-Maker Village' and nowadays the community fill the jars (which come from elsewhere) with láo-láo, the local rice whisky. Overnight in Luang Prabang.
Day 3 :
Luang Prabang (B) : Excursion to Kuang Si Waterfalls located in a perfect natural setting near Luang Prabang this multi-tiered waterfall tumbles over limestone formations into a series of turquoise pools. Visit Ban Tha Pene, National Museum (former Royal Palace, closed on Tuesdays), Mount Phousi. Overnight in Luang Prabang.
Day 4 :
Luang Prabang (B) : Day free at leisure. Transfer to airport for departure.
